Things as they are: that the checkered print is one of the main trends of autumn-winter is a proven fact. And we don’t say it: the best designers say it and those who know the most about fashion bet on it non-stop. For example, Louis Vuitton and Altuzarra have chosen paintings preppy 1970s, while Balmain and Chanel, among others, have opted for the pied-de-poule print and Dior and Saint Laurent have opted for the tartan print. Pair them with your basics and neutrals to balance the look.
